Attorney General Bill Barr REFUSES to testify about Mueller

The Justice Department said Barr would not show up for a House Judiciary Committee hearing on Thursday because the Democratic-led panel had overruled Barr’s objections and would allow staff lawyers to question him. As you can imagine Democrats are furious with some of them asking for his resignation. Democratic Caucus chairman Hakeem Jeffries, D-N.Y., said Wednesday afternoon that Democrats "plan on subpoenaing" Barr "if he decides not to show up."

Federal lawmakers have only cited one U.S. attorney general for contempt, Eric Holder of the Obama administration, for refusing to hand over documents related to the 'Operation Fast and Furious' gun-running scandal that plagued the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ives.
